View moreThe U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service has issued a combined synopsis and solicitation under solicitation number 140FC326Q0026 for the installation of an outdoor drinking fountain at the San Diego National Wildlife Refuge Complex Headquarters in Chula Vista, California. The scope of work involves removing two existing outdoor drinking fountains and installing one ADA-compliant drinking fountain with an integrated bottle refill station on an existing concrete foundation. The government-furnished unit has already been purchased, and the contractor will be responsible for connecting it to the existing potable water line in compliance with state and local laws. This project is classified under NAICS 238990, All Other Specialty Trade Contractors, and PSC Z2CZ, Repair or Alteration of Other Educational Buildings.
The construction magnitude for this firm-fixed-price contract is estimated between $5,000 and $11,000. This procurement is designated as a Total Small Business Set Aside under the SBA (Small Business Administration) program. The anticipated period of performance spans 124 days, currently scheduled from June 19, 2026, through September 18, 2026. The contracting office, FWS Construction & A/E - BIL/Disaster, requires that all quotes be submitted by the response deadline of June 19, 2026. Terrence Anderson serves as the primary point of contact for this requirement.
The solicitation includes four attachments: a Statement of Work, the original solicitation document, an amendment, and a solicitation attachment posted on June 8, 2026. Evaluation for award will be based on price and the responsible source's ability to demonstrate relevant experience in water fountain installation and construction. Contractors must be registered in the System for Award Management (SAM) and are required to provide payment and performance bonds due to the project magnitude. General Wage Rate Decision Number CA20260001 applies to all work performed under this contract in San Diego County.
